About Industrial Mogul

Industrial Mogul - about the game

Industrial Mogul is a strategy game focused on building and managing complex industrial empires on PC. Players oversee every stage of production, from extracting raw materials to delivering finished goods to consumers, while navigating a dynamic economy and shaping the development of entire regions through the early and mid-20th century.

Gameplay

The core loop centers on constructing and linking multi-stage production chains. Farms supply wheat that moves through mills into flour and then bread. Mines yield iron ore that becomes steel and machinery. Cotton fields feed textile operations that produce fabric and clothing. Crude oil refines into fuel and more advanced items. Each facility requires steady inputs, balanced output, and reliable transport to avoid bottlenecks or surpluses that affect pricing and storage.

Players expand workshops into larger networks as technology advances. Shortages ripple through the system and halt downstream production, while excess output lowers prices and fills warehouses. Logistics connect extraction sites, factories, warehouses, and retail outlets across regions. Success depends on matching capacity at every step rather than simply adding more buildings.

Goods draw from real historical categories of the period, including canned foods, corn flakes, bottled milk, clothing, household items, typewriters, radios, appliances, steam vehicles, and early automobiles. Each product carries a note on its origins and societal role. Fictional brands allow custom identities that improve quality, visibility, and customer loyalty over time.

Markets react to supply, demand, population size, income levels, and rival actions. Setting prices, securing resources, and choosing when to scale or pivot industries determine profitability. Cities expand when provided with jobs and goods, creating new labor pools and consumption needs. Poor planning or narrow specialization can stall growth in a settlement.

Research determines which technologies and products enter the world. New methods, materials, engines, and consumer items become available through player or competitor efforts. On stricter settings, breakthroughs require active investment; otherwise, progress may occur gradually. This system supports alternative timelines where familiar inventions appear later, in different forms, or not at all.

Game Modes

Industrial Mogul centers on single-player campaigns played across procedurally generated maps. Each campaign presents unique geography, resource distributions, city placements, and economic conditions. Players select starting difficulty and customize rules that affect how technology advances and how much the world develops independently.

Campaigns emphasize long-term planning over multiple eras. Different starting conditions and rule sets produce varied paths, from resource-rich agricultural zones to mineral-heavy industrial hubs. Competitors operate under the same systems, expanding into markets and pursuing their own research goals.

No separate multiplayer or versus modes appear in the available information. The focus remains on managing one company against AI rivals within a living economic simulation that evolves based on collective decisions.

World Building and Progression

Procedurally generated maps ensure every campaign offers distinct regional opportunities. One area might excel in farmland but lack minerals, while another supports heavy industry through deposits and transport access. Players decide where to locate facilities, which cities to supply, and how regions should specialize to create efficient networks.

Technological progress shapes the available products and transport options. Early campaigns may rely on steam power, while successful research unlocks internal combustion engines or new materials. When no one develops a key technology, the world continues without it, leading to different product mixes and economic structures across playthroughs.

Brand building adds another layer. Improving quality and awareness turns standard goods into recognizable names that command loyalty and higher margins even against cheaper alternatives. This reputation helps defend market share as rivals enter established industries.

Is It Worth Playing?

Industrial Mogul suits players who enjoy detailed economic strategy and production management. The emphasis on interconnected chains, supply-and-demand pricing, and city growth creates a cohesive simulation where decisions in one area affect distant parts of the map.

Customizable difficulty and rules allow adjustment for different experience levels. Those who prefer systems that reward careful balancing and long-term planning will find depth in the logistics and research layers. The absence of confirmed player reviews or update history at this stage means prospective buyers should evaluate based on the described mechanics alone.

The game appeals most to fans of tycoon-style titles that combine resource extraction, manufacturing, and market competition without relying on combat or action elements. Its procedurally generated worlds and alternative-history potential provide replay value through varied starting conditions and technological outcomes.
